I have chronic condition(s) and have enrolled in Healthier SG. How do I know which subsidy (Existing CHAS Chronic Tier or the Healthier SG Chronic Tier) to use for my chronic condition(s) medication?
Patients with chronic conditions that have high medication needs and bills are likely to benefit from the Healthier SG Chronic Tier.
You may wish to consult with your enrolled Healthier SG doctor about whether you are suitable to switch to use selected common chronic medications* that are eligible for percentage subsidies under the Healthier SG Chronic Tier.
*Additional subsides for Medication Assistance Fund (MAF) medications on the Healthier SG Medication List are available only for CHAS Blue and CHAS Orange cardholders (including PG/MG cardholders who also hold a CHAS Blue/Orange card).
